Hoia Baciu Forest, Romania

Origins and local legends

Hoia Baciu Forest, also known as ‘the Bermuda Triangle of Romania,’ is steeped in mystery and legend. Locals have spun tales about this place for years, often warning visitors about wandering too deep into its bewitching vegetation. Originating from the name of a shepherd who disappeared within the forest’s green abyss with his flock of two hundred sheep, the forest has become synonymous with eerie disappearances.

Paranormal sightings and experiences

Myths often stem from grains of truth, and there’s certainly no shortage of strange occurrences in the Hoia Baciu Forest. Some accounts include strange apparitions, ghostly figures lurking just out of sight, and odd geometric patterns appearing in the forest’s foliage. There have also been numerous accounts of visitors feeling inexplicably anxious or watched within the forest’s depths.

Aokigahara Forest, Japan

Historical context and folklore

Tucked at the base of Mount Fuji is Aokigahara Forest, a dense woodland known for its lush vegetation and absolute silence. Its historical context only adds to its eerie ambiance, with folklore tales suggesting that the forest was once a site for ‘Ubasute,’ an ancient practice where the elderly were allegedly abandoned in secluded areas during times of famine.

Notorious reputation as ‘The Suicide Forest’

Unfortunately, Aokigahara has garnered a chilling reputation as ‘The Suicide Forest,’ being one of the most prevalent suicide locations worldwide. Its quiet, thick greenery and isolation have drawn many to end their lives here, a fact that’s only heightened its haunting reputation.

Present-day tourism and the forest’s eerie ambiance

Despite its disquieting reputation, Aokigahara sees its share of tourists. Many are attracted to the stark contrast between the forest’s natural beauty and its terrifying folklore. If you find yourself brave enough to venture into its serenely silent trails, remember to respect the space and those who’ve lost their lives there.

Black Forest, Germany

The lore and myths of the Black Forest

Germany’s Black Forest is a massive swath of deep green pine trees that seem to darken the earth beneath it. Its name alone evokes images of mystery and folklore, and rightly so. The forest has been a rich source of countless legends, including tales of witches, werewolves, and other supernatural entities said to dwell within its expanses.

Famous ghost and witch stories

Among some of the most famous ghost stories around Black Forest is the legend of ‘The Lady in White’—a ghostly apparition that will guide lost travelers to safety. But equally woven into the forest’s mythology are tales of witches meeting during the night of Walpurgis, casting spells beneath the immense spruce trees.

Exploring the Black Forest today

In stark contrast to its spooky folktales, Black Forest is a popular tourist destination today. From Cathedral-like pines to historical farmhouses and world-renowned cuckoo clocks, the forest provides an intriguing glimpse into a world where beauty and spookiness intertwine.

Dering Woods, England

‘The Screaming Woods’ and their haunted history

Better recognized as ‘The Screaming Woods’, Dering Woods echoes with a haunted past. Nestled near the quaint village of Pluckley, the woods have long been the subject of ghostly legends, mournful spirits, and eerie screams that supposedly echo through the trees during the night.

Paranormal encounters in the woods

There are numerous accounts of paranormal sightings within the woods—ranging from gusts of winds silencing abruptly, strange lights flickering through the trees, and unexplainable footsteps getting disconcertingly close before vanishing.

Village experiences and reactions over the years

The local villagers of Pluckley have lived in harmony with the woods, albeit with earned caution. There seems to be an unspoken agreement to treat the woods with respect—careful not to anger the spirits that might reside there.

Dow Hill Forest, India

Infamous ‘Death Road’ and hauntings

The dark allure of Dow Hill Forest lies in its infamous ‘Death Road’—a stretch of forested roadway believed to be haunted. According to local lore, a headless boy has often been spotted wandering and disappearing without a trace in this terrifying section of the woods.

School ghost and other paranormal activities

Several eerie tales are deeply associated with the old Victoria Boys School located in the vicinity. Strange words scribbled on blackboards, disembodied footsteps during holidays, and a woman spotted walking in the corridors are just some accounts fueling the haunted reputation.

Visitor experiences and warnings

Tourists who visit Dow Hill Forest often encounter eerie experiences. Local advice is to be respectful and considerate, especially if visiting the ‘Death Road.’ The vibe here can be unnerving; it’s a place where nature’s beauty and eerie quiet can quickly transform into an experience straight out of a horror film.

Pine Barrens, New Jersey, USA

Haunted tales of the New Jersey Devil

Pine Barrens is widely known for its folkloric creature, the New Jersey Devil. This strange entity, described as having hooves, wings and a forked tail, has reportedly been seen over hundreds of years by credible witnesses, and remains one of America’s most enduring legends.

Unsolved mysteries and strange occurrences

Beyond the infamous New Jersey Devil, Pine Barrens has been the scene of numerous unexplained phenomena. These include strange light sightings, ghostly apparitions, and sounds that don’t quite line up with the typical forest noises.

Contemporary accounts and research

Despite extensive research and investigation, many of the phenomena in the Pine Barrens remain unexplained. Contemporary accounts and witnesses still repeatedly report odd happenings, further cementing its reputation as one of the most haunted forests in the world.

Epping Forest, England

England’s longest forest and its haunted past

Stretching over 6,000 acres, England’s longest forest, Epping Forest, once served as a royal hunting ground. Despite its beautiful scenery, this forest bears a macabre history filled with highwaymen legends, gangsters, and a chilling haunted reputation.

Ghost stories and highwayman legends

From the ghost of a hefty police horse to tales of notorious highwayman Dick Turpin’s ghost haunting the forest, Epping has a wealth of scary stories. Many have reported hearing hoofbeats or seeing ghostly figures by the road, adding a creepy tone to the forest’s appeal.

Visiting the haunted site today

Currently a popular spot for hikers and campers, those with a taste for the paranormal still visit Epping Forest. Its rich history, coupled with countless ghost stories, makes it an interesting (if somewhat unsettling) place for an outdoorsy outing.

Freetown State Forest, Massachusetts, USA

Sightings of ghosts, bigfoot, and UFOs

From ghosts and Bigfoot to UFOs, Freetown State Forest has its share of unexplainable sightings. Satanic cult rituals, phantom fires, and unidentifiable night creatures are just some of the fascinating tales you’ll hear about this woodland.

The forest’s place in the Bridgewater Triangle

Located in the heart of the infamous Bridgewater Triangle—an area known for numerous inexplicable encounters—Freetown State Forest only amplifies the area’s general eeriness. Many consider this forest the most haunted section within that already unsettling territory.

Recent accounts and experiences

Today, despite the timeline of strange occurrences, locals and visitors continue to use Freetown State Forest for various recreation activities. Not everyone reports eerie experiences, but an odd encounter can never truly be ruled out in this infamous forest.

Island of the Dolls, Xochimilco, Mexico

Unravelling the creepy doll legend

The Island of the Dolls holds one of the creepiest legends in the world. The story began with a local man, Julian Santana Barrera, who hung dolls to protect himself from a child’s supposed ghost. Today, hundreds of eerie dolls hang from the trees, creating a terrifying tableau.

Paranormal activities on the island

Paranormal enthusiasts have claimed to hear the dolls whispering to each other, while others say they’ve seen the dolls’ eyes following their movements. This chilling sensation has earned the Island of Dolls a spot amongst the world’s most haunted places.

Visiting the acclaimed ‘most terrifying place on Earth’

This small island is now a dark tourist spot where visitors can witness firsthand the hundreds of fear-inducing dolls. While not for the faint-hearted, it undoubtedly creates an unforgettable (albeit horrifying) experience.
